## Authentication

This section covers auth for the Glimwick cache-diagnostics tool, added after the stale-cache incident (see postmortem PM-glimwick-stale). Support staff use this tool to confirm whether a customer is seeing cached or live data. All requests go through the internal diagnostics gateway, which rejects unauthenticated calls with a 403 and logs the attempt. Do not share credentials in tickets; reference the tool's output instead. The gateway authenticates the tool with a single shared service key, which is provided below.

API key for tagef-fafop: vxb2-ta

Handover — TaxRate cache (Lindqvist & Co)

Welcome aboard! You're inheriting the Perch cache that fronts our tax-rate lookups. Main things: it warms from the Ledgerby feed at 02:00, TTL is 6 hours, and the invalidation hook is flaky on Tuesdays (known bug, see the Perch board). Staging mirrors prod except for the sandbox rates. Admin access goes through the sealed ops vault — nobody's unsealed it since Priya left. To unseal it, use the recovery passphrase below.

unlock words, yageg-faweg: briael-quenox-rusox

**Fire-drill roll call — quick guide**

When the alarm sounds at Pellam Court, the facilities desk grabs the roll-call tablet and heads to Muster Point C by the bike shed. Tick off names as people arrive and flag stragglers to the warden. The tablet lives in the red wall box by the side exit — unlock it with the code below.

turnstile pass: bdg-NG-3

Minutes — Management Meeting, Brayholt Instruments

Attendees: S. Kellner (chair), J. Morvane, P. Adesco. Circulated to sales leads.

1. Marketing budget reduced by 18% for the remainder of the fiscal year, effective next month.
2. Trade show participation limited to the Fernlow Expo only; digital campaigns continue at reduced spend.
3. Morvane to brief agency partners this week.
4. Sales leads asked to adjust pipeline forecasts accordingly by Friday.

The confidential note on business plans appears directly below.

board note of fahag-tajop: The eastern region missed its Julix quota by 44.0 percent last quarter. Ralionax Holdings plans to lower the Druath list price by 61.8 percent in March. The board signed off on a budget of $295.0 million for Project Gilath. The renewal with Ruswynix Systems closes at $274.5 million a year, 17.0 percent above the last contract.